Factors Influencing Average Lunch Cost
The cost of lunch depends on various factors including location, type of cuisine, and method of purchase. Urban areas with a higher cost of living tend to charge more for meals. Additionally, opting for healthier or specialty foods usually increases average expenses.
Location and Region
Lunch costs vary by region, with cities like New York, Los Angeles, and San Francisco typically featuring higher prices than smaller cities or rural areas. For example, a lunchtime meal in Manhattan averages around $15 or more, while in smaller towns, it could be closer to $8 or less.
Type of Dining Establishment
The kind of place you eat determines pricing: fast-food chains offer economical options, casual dining and cafes charge moderately, whereas fine dining establishments can cost significantly more for lunch. Understanding your dining setting is crucial to estimating average lunch expenses.

Cost Breakdown of a Typical Lunch Meal
Understanding individual components of your lunch can reveal where your money goes. Below is a typical breakdown of common lunch items and their average prices across the country.
| Item | Average Cost (USD) |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Sandwich or Burger | $5 – $9 | Main entree in fast food or casual lunch menus |
| Side (Fries, Salad, Soup) | $2 – $5 | Common accompaniments increasing total cost |
| Beverage (Soda, Water, Coffee) | $1 – $3 | Drinks vary widely based on choice and establishment |
| Dessert (Optional) | $2 – $5 | Cookies, pastries, or small sweet treats at some cafes |

Impact of Special Diets on Average Lunch Cost
Diets such as vegan, gluten-free, or organic meals often increase the average lunch price due to specialized ingredients and preparation methods. Restaurants, particularly those catering to health-conscious customers, may charge premiums for these options.
Examples of Special Diet Price Variations
- Vegan Lunches: Typically cost $1-3 more than standard meals.
- Gluten-Free Options: Slight price premium for specialty bread or pasta.
- Organic Ingredients: Meals made with organic produce and meats can add $2-5 to the meal’s cost.
Daily and Monthly Lunch Budgeting
Accounting for lunch costs helps in weekly and monthly budget planning. Below is an estimated cost illustration assuming a 5-day workweek.
| Lunch Type | Cost Per Meal (USD) | Weekly Cost (5 Days) | Monthly Cost (20 Days)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Fast Food | $7.50 | $37.50 | $150 |
| Casual Dining | $16 | $80 | $320 |
| Home-Packed Lunch | $5 | $25 | $100 |
| Meal Delivery Services | $12.50 | $62.50 | $250 |
